Caseload Handled by School Counsellors

Speakers

Transcript

10 Mr Louis Ng Kok Kwang asked the Minister for Education (a) for each year in the past five years, what is the mean and median number of (i) students handled by each school counsellor and (ii) hours spent with each student by each school counsellor; and (b) if the data is not currently collected, whether the Ministry will consider collecting this data.

Mr Chan Chun Sing: In the past five years, each School Counsellor supports an average of 70 students with social-emotional and mental health issues annually. The time spent on each case varies according to the student's needs and the intensity of support required. The Ministry of Education does not track the time spent on each case and has no plans to do so. Besides counselling students, School Counsellors also work closely with school personnel, community partners and parents on other aspects of the ecosystem of support for students, such as in planning preventive programmes.
